Playing with ideas and language can help you become the writer you've always wanted to be.
30 imaginative exercises will stretch your writing skills and take you in new and unexpected directions.
They cover:

  1. Character creation
  2. Suspense and the traditional tropes of horror writing
  3. Humour even if you can’t tell a joke
  4. Plotting and Planning
  5. Poetry exercises for writers who do NOT want to write a poem
  6. How to write description that does more than describe
  7. How to write natural sounding dialogue that isn’t too natural…

Informazioni sull'autore

Bridget Whelan is a novelist, prize winning short story writer and creative writing lecturer who has taught on undergraduate courses and in adult education. She has also been Writer in Residence at a community centre for the unemployed and low waged. You can meet Bridget online at http://bridgetwhelan.com/
